我想检查我单击的元素(this)是否具有特定属性,作为if子句中的条件。是否可以使用JavaScript或jQuery执行此操作?谢谢 最佳答案 我会给出非jQuery答案,只是为了好玩和咯咯笑。this.hasAttribute("foo")文档:https://developer.mozilla.org/en/DOM/element.hasAttribute 关于javascript-如何检查'this'是否具有特定属性?,我们在StackOverflow上找到一个类似的问题:
为了让map链接像以前一样打开map应用程序,我想根据用户使用的是iOS6还是其他(iOS4、5、Android等)呈现不同的链接。类似于:--如果在iOS6.0或更高版本上,显示http://maps.apple.com?q=“地址”,如果其他,显示http://maps.google.com?q=“地址”。注意:我知道您也可以直接调用map应用程序而不是通过网络链接(现在手边没有),但这不能解决问题,因为有人在Android或更小的iOS上将没有用处。 最佳答案 您可以使用navigator.userAgent字符串检测iOS版
我想使用momentjs倒计时直到特定事件发生,但我得到了意想不到的结果。今天的日期是4月17日,事件日期是5月14日,我希望得到的天数是27,但我的代码给出的结果是57。有什么问题吗?functiondaysRemaining(){vareventdate=moment([2015,5,14]);vartodaysdate=moment();returneventdate.diff(todaysdate,'days');}alert(daysRemaining()); 最佳答案 使用数组创建moment对象时,必须注意月、时、分、
我有一个对象,我想遍历该对象的一些特定键。如何实现?考虑下面的片段:我如何遍历table1、table2和table3键而不是全部?vartable_object={table1:"helloworld",table1_name:"greetings_english.html",table2:"hola",table2_name:"greetings_spanish.html",table3:"Bonjour",table3_name:"greetings_french.html"}; 最佳答案 您可以过滤键,然后迭代其余键。var
查找特定按键的键码的最简单方法是什么?有没有什么好的在线工具可以捕获任何关键事件并显示代码?我想尝试在带有网络浏览器的移动设备上查找特殊键的键码,所以在线工具会很棒。 最佳答案 $(function(){$(document).keyup(function(e){console.log(e.keyCode);});});这是您的在线工具。 关于javascript-如何找到特定键的键码,我们在StackOverflow上找到一个类似的问题: https://s
我一直在为一些可能微不足道的事情浪费时间:我有一个逗号分隔的电子邮件地址列表,我想将其转换为特定的JSON格式,以便与MandrillAPI(https://mandrillapp.com/api/docs/messages.JSON.html)一起使用我的字符串:varto='bigbadwolf@grannysplace.com,hungry@hippos.com,youtalkin@to.me';它需要什么(我认为):[{"email":"bigbadwolf@grannysplace.com"},{"email":"hungry@hippos.com"},{"email":"y
我正在研究条形码扫描仪。我使用的条形码扫描器是即插即用类型,无论您将光标放在何处,它都会自动扫描代码。但我想要的是,每次我的扫描仪读取代码时,我是否可以将它扫描到网页上的特定文本框例如,如果我的表格看起来像这样所以每次我扫描代码时,无论我当前的焦点在哪里,它都应该始终出现在txtitem文本框中。有人可以指导我或帮助我在这里找到解决方案吗?? 最佳答案 一些条形码扫描仪就像另一个输入设备一样。除非您使用计时器来监控输入信息的速度,否则表单无法区分键盘输入的信息与扫描仪输入的信息之间的区别。一些扫描器将值“粘贴”到焦点控件中-其他扫描
我想在用户单击该div之外的页面上的任意位置时隐藏该div。我怎样才能使用原始javascript或jQuery做到这一点? 最佳答案 将点击事件附加到文档以隐藏div:$(document).click(function(e){$('#somediv').hide();});将点击事件附加到div以阻止点击它传播到文档:$('#somediv').click(function(e){e.stopPropagation();}); 关于javascript-在特定div之外的页面上的任何
我是GoogleChrome推送通知的新手,我刚刚在stackoverflow上阅读了一些问题和答案,我以这个简单的推送通知javascript结束了。navigator.serviceWorker.register('sw.js');functionnotify(){Notification.requestPermission(function(result){if(result==='granted'){navigator.serviceWorker.ready.then(function(registration){registration.showNotification('t
我正在使用Laravel5.4,我刚刚开始学习firebase消息传递,我想在我的网络浏览器上获取通知如果有人发送。我实现的是,在母版页中,我导入了firebase脚本,如下所示:resources/views/layouts/master.blade.php:firebase.initializeApp({'messagingSenderId':'1***************2'//i.e.Myfirebasekey});constmessaging=firebase.messaging();{{HTML::script('firebase-messaging-sw.js')}}